Google yesterday announced that it is increasing the price of G Suite by 20 percent. This is the first time Google is increasing the price of its productivity suite since its launch. G Suite Basic Edition will increase by $1 (from $5 to $6 per user/month) and G Suite Business Edition will increase by $2 (from $10 to $12 per user/month). Pricing for G Suite Enterprise Edition customers will remain the same. This pricing change will take effect from April 2, 2019.

This price change by Google makes G Suite costlier than equivalent Office 365 offerings. For example, Office 365 Business Essentials (equivalent of G Suite Basic) costs only $5 user/month and Office 365 Business Premium (equivalent of G Suite Business) costs only $12.50 per user/month. It is important to note that for the extra $0.5 you pay for Office 365 Business Premium when compared to G Suite, you get desktop versions of Office applications including Outlook, Word, Excel, PowerPoint, OneNote, Access and Publisher. Also access to premium business applications like Outlook Customer Manager, Microsoft Invoicing, Microsoft Bookings, and MileIQ.
